簡體   English   中英

Azure AD B2C - 創建應用注冊后立即出現錯誤 AADB2C90018

[英]Azure AD B2C - Error AADB2C90018 immediately after the app registration was created

我有一個多租戶應用程序,我使用 Azure B2C 作為身份提供者。 每個租戶都有自己的應用程序注冊(具有不同的重定向 URL)。 應用程序注冊是在租戶創建時以編程方式創建的。

創建后,當我將用戶重定向到登錄頁面時,Azure B2C 立即收到以下錯誤:

AADB2C90018: The client id '<just-created-app-id>' specified in the request is not registered in tenant '<my-tenant>'.

幾秒鍾后,相同的 URL 將按預期工作。 我假設應用程序注冊創建是由 Azure B2C 異步執行的,並最終被處理。

問題:如何確保在新應用注冊功能正常之前不會將用戶重定向到 Azure B2C?

這是由於 AAD 目錄層中的復制延遲。 將依賴 App Id 的后續操作延遲一分鍾(復制通常在跨區域的 10 秒內發生)。 這為應用程序 object 復制到所有 DC 提供了足夠的時間。

https://docs.microsoft.com/en-us/azure/active-directory/fundamentals/active-directory-architecture#azure-ad-architecture

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M